What Is Onshape?

At its core, Onshape is a cloud-based CAD (computer-aided design) platform delivered as Software-as-a-Service (SaaS). Unlike traditional CAD systems that require installation on powerful local machines, Onshape operates entirely in the cloud.

This means no downloads or installations, no local file storage, and no manual updates. Instead, everything (from 3D modeling to data management) lives in a secure cloud environment that you can access from any device.

But Onshape isn’t just CAD. It combines 3D CAD modeling, built-in Product Data Management (PDM), and real-time collaboration tools within a single platform. This unified approach eliminates the need for separate systems and simplifies the entire product development process.

What’s PTC Onshape? Understanding the Platform

If you’ve heard the term “PTC Onshape,” you might be wondering how it fits into the bigger picture.

Onshape was acquired by PTC in 2019, bringing it into a broader ecosystem of product development solutions that includes tools like Creo (CAD), Windchill (PLM), and ThingWorx (IoT).

Within this ecosystem, Onshape stands out as:

  • PTC’s cloud-native CAD solution
  • A platform designed for modern, distributed teams
  • A key part of digital transformation strategies in engineering

Unlike legacy CAD tools that were adapted for the cloud, Onshape was built cloud-first from day one. That distinction matters. It enables capabilities that simply aren’t possible with file-based systems.

When people ask, “what’s PTC Onshape?”, the best answer is this:

It’s a fully cloud-native product development platform that combines CAD, data management, and collaboration into one seamless experience.

How Does Onshape Work?

Onshape’s power comes from its architecture. By moving everything to the cloud, it fundamentally changes how teams interact with design data.

Fully Cloud-Based Architecture

Onshape runs on remote servers, not your local machine. All you need is a web browser or mobile app.

This means you can work from virtually any device. Additionally, performance isn’t limited by your hardware, and your data is always backed up and secure.

There are no files to manage because designs are stored centrally in the cloud.

Real-Time Collaboration

One of Onshape’s most impactful features is real-time collaboration.

Multiple users can work on the same design simultaneously, see changes instantly, and leave comments directly within the model. Think of it like Google Docs, but for CAD.

It eliminates version conflicts, file duplication, and lengthy check-in/check-out processes. The result? Faster design cycles and better team alignment.

Built-In Data Management (PDM)

Traditional CAD systems often require a separate PDM system to manage files, revisions, and approvals. Onshape changes that by building PDM directly into the platform. Key capabilities include automatic version control, branching and merging design changes, and full design history tracking.

Because everything is integrated, there’s no risk of losing data or working from outdated files.

Key Features of Onshape

Onshape’s feature set is designed to simplify workflows and improve productivity across the product development lifecycle.

Some of the most notable features include:

  • Cloud-native 3D CAD modeling
  • Real-time collaboration across teams
  • Integrated PDM and version control
  • Automatic updates with new features delivered continuously
  • Cross-device accessibility (desktop, tablet, mobile)
  • Integrated tools for simulation, rendering, and manufacturing workflows

One of the biggest advantages? Updates happen automatically, typically every few weeks, so your team always has access to the latest capabilities without downtime.

Onshape vs Traditional CAD

To fully understand the value of Onshape, it helps to compare it to traditional CAD systems.

Traditional CAD:

  • Installed locally
  • File-based workflows
  • Manual version control
  • Limited collaboration
  • Periodic updates

Onshape:

  • Runs in the cloud
  • No files, data is centrally managed
  • Built-in version control
  • Real-time collaboration
  • Continuous updates

The difference is more than technical. It’s a shift in how teams approach product development.

Onshape removes the friction caused by files and enables a more connected, agile workflow.

Is Onshape Right for Your Organization?

Onshape is particularly well-suited for organizations that:

  • Have distributed or remote teams
  • Want to eliminate file-based workflows
  • Are looking to reduce IT complexity
  • Are investing in digital transformation

However, there are a few considerations. A reliable internet connection is required. And teams may need time to adjust from traditional CAD systems. That said, for many organizations, the benefits far outweigh the transition effort.
